  • Abstract
    This talk will present and discuss an enzyme-catalyzed “green” synthesis of unnatural poly(amino acid)s and their dendronized analogues. It will be shown how DL-tyrosine could be polymerized under environmentally friendly conditions using linear-dendritic laccase complexes as initiators and water as solvent. The influence of the dendron generation in the linear-dendritic copolymers, the monomer concentration, time and temperature on the polymers yields and molecular masses will be discussed along with the structure of the poly(tyrosine) as investigated by NMR, FT-IR and MALDI-TOF. The synthesis of dendritic tyrosine monomers of different generations will also be presented. The materials formed by both polymerizations are completely water-soluble and behave either as typical poly(zwitterions) or like macro-amphiphiles, changing charge, size and shape with the medium pH and generation of the dendritic side groups. Potential biomedical applications will be outlined.
